Protest against Israeli attack on Gaza

Staff Reporter

Demand to rush humanitarian aid to Palestinian people and end the siege

United we stand: Palestinians along with CPI (M-L)-New Democracy activists demonstrating in New Delhi on Friday in protest against the U.S backed Israeli attack on Gaza.

NEW DELHI: The Delhi Committee of the Communist Party of India (Marxist-Leninist)-New Democracy organised a protest demonstration at Jantar Mantar here on Friday demanding an end to the “US-backed Israeli attacks on Gaza”.

Supporting the Palestinian people’s long struggle, the protesters raised slogans against American imperialism and Israel’s Zionist rulers.

Addressing the protesters, party leaders condemned the Israeli attack launched after a long siege.

“In the current attacks, a large number of children, women and men have been killed and injured and it is a matter of shame that not only has the United States supported the attack openly, even other Western countries are yet to move international forums to put pressure on Israel,” said a statement issued by the party.

“The Israeli Government and the US have never accepted the electoral victory of the Hamas and in this attack the Hamas is being targeted along with random killing of civilians,” said the release, demanding that Israel rebuild Gaza and end the siege.

Speakers at the protest also demanded that Prime Minister Manmohan Singh downgrade the relationship with Israel and rush humanitarian aid to Gaza.
